What is the primary purpose of the Balanced Scorecard framework?

Explanation:
The primary purpose of the Balanced Scorecard framework is to facilitate planning and management using metrics. This framework provides organizations with a structured approach to transform strategic objectives into specific performance measures. It emphasizes the importance of balancing financial and non-financial metrics across different perspectives, such as financial, customer, internal processes, and learning & growth. By using this approach, organizations can gain a comprehensive view of their performance and ensure that all aspects of their operations are aligned with their strategic goals. The Balanced Scorecard helps in tracking progress, identifying improvement areas, and making informed decisions based on measurable outcomes, thus steering the organization towards achieving its long-term objectives. This focus on strategic management and performance measurement is what distinguishes the Balanced Scorecard from other business tools that might concentrate on areas like pricing strategies, customer loyalty, or employee engagement in isolation.
